Supreme Court Rules Against Worker Pay for Security Screenings
In the recent case of Integrity Staffing Solutions, Inc. v. Busk , the United States Supreme Court ruled unanimously this month that a temp agency was not required to pay workers at Amazon warehouses for the time they spent waiting to go through a security screening at the ...
